T. M. Morgan fonds

  • MJ-137
  • Fonds
  • [1914-1918]

This fonds contains Lieutenant T. M Morgan’s photo album of the timber operation by No. 106 Company, Canadian Forestry Corps during the First World War. The photographs were taken in Knockando, Moray-shire, Scotland. Most of the photographs are labeled. T. M. Morgan is the first on the left of the last row of the unlabeled group photo.

The Collegiate Outlook collection

  • MJ-126
  • Collection
  • 1906-1914

This collection contains 26 copies of The Collegiate Outlook from 1906-1914. The Collegiate Outlook was a school magazine published from November to March by the Literary Society of the Moose Jaw High School. It contains essays and jokes written by students, as well as meeting minutes of the Literary Society. These issues were mailed to Mrs. Roy E. Tree Nursery (P.F.R.A) Fonds

  • TNF
  • Fonds
  • 2010 - 2013

The fonds was donated to the museum in 2012 by staff of the Government of Canada’s Agroforestry Centre, prior to its closure in 2014. From 1901 to 2013, the nursery provided over 650 million tree and shrub seedlings and rooted cuttings (poplar and willow) to the prairie regions of Manitoba, Saskatchewan and Alberta, as well as the Peace River District of BC for use in farmyard, field and roadside shelterbelts for wind, snow and erosion control. It was the major single employer in Indian Head for most of its existence.
It was previously known as the Shelterbelt Centre, the Tree Nursery and the Forest Nursery Station and belonged, at times, to the Department of the Interior, the Department of Regional and Economic Expansion and Agriculture and Agri-Food Canada. It operated under the Prairie Farm Rehabilitation Administration (PFRA) from 1963 to 2008 and under the Agri-Environment Service Branch (AESB) from 2008 to 2013.
The distribution of trees and shrubs for shelter was initiated by Angus MacKay, first superintendent of the Experimental Farm. Because of the rapid increase in demand by farmers, a dedicated Forest Nursery Station was created south of Indian Head.
The fonds contains historic reports, publications, correspondence and documents from 1890 to 1994. All of the items are contained in letter-sized plastic sleeves. The slides are grouped in the cabinet by subject area and by years and are all numbered and titled and indexed in two accompanying binders that are used as a finding aid. Most of the slides are technical in nature (pictures of trees and shrubs, insects, shelterbelts, etc.) but some categories include people who were, in some way, involved in the shelterbelt program.
